  • Abstract
    Three possible methods of detecting recorded speech were analysed and tested according to their applicability in the field of voicemail detection in this paper. Methods chosen for testing were: transmission channel characteristics extraction with PFCC, recorded speech detection with trained pattern classifier, differences in transmission channels and speech recognition. Most of the tests gave results credible enough to confirm methods´ usefulness in the field of voicemail detection. Suggestions of implementation possibilities and parameters of each method and possible trends of further studies were also included.
